Role Overview

This is a great opportunity for you to become a key member of our Aftersales team.

An exciting new opportunity has come up here at our Maidstone dealership as we’re on the lookout for a Senior Customer Advisor to join our team.

It is the perfect opportunity for a talented and passionate individual to advance their career in a premium manufacturer owned environment.

As a customer advisor you will be the key link between our customers and our technicians, guiding each customer through the Stellantis &You customer journey.

In this role you will also

  • Communicate clearly with customers & colleagues.
  • Adopt new digital systems and processes as part of our digitalisation strategy.
  • Propose and sell‑up the additional work advised through the Vehicle Health Check process.
  • Quote & sell Service Plans to retain customers to the group.

You will also be the go-to person when the customer wants us to

  • Estimate repair costs and times.
  • Resolve any concerns when we suggest repairs.
  • Inform and update them on progress or additional works needed.
  • Prepare and explain invoices and take payments.

How to prepare for a job interview at Stellantis &You UK

Show Off Your People Skills

In customer support, it's all about communicating effectively. Prepare to share instances from your past experiences where you handled difficult customers or resolved conflicts. We want to hear how you empathised and found the best solutions, so think of specific examples to back up your stories!

Know the Tools of the Trade

Familiarise yourself with common customer support tools like Zendesk or Freshdesk, and make sure to review how you’ve used any similar systems in the past. During the interview, being able to discuss your hands-on experience with software or ticketing systems can really set you apart from the competition, so don’t skip this prep!

Show Genuine Enthusiasm

As this is a full-time role, employers want someone who isn’t just looking for any job, but wants to grow within customer support. Make sure to express your enthusiasm for helping customers and your desire to develop your skills. Show them why you're passionate about this field!

Practice Common Scenarios

Be prepared for role-playing scenarios where you might have to reassess a solution with a frustrated customer or explain a complex process in simple terms. Practising these common scenarios can help us feel more confident and demonstrate our practical skills effectively during the interview.
